Now the “meat and potatoes” of the job.
- We receive furniture products of many types either at our company warehouse or direct at a customer location.
- We unload, de-box, de-trash, stage, assemble, and prep all products for end-user use.
- We lift, move, hang on walls, reconfigure, load and unload, transport product each and every day.
- We work in all types of businesses, schools, hospitals, hotels, etc. and polite interaction with clients and other trades is very important.
